Break-out Sessions - 9 AM
These sessions will deal with topics identified as critical to
successful implementation of field automation projects.
* Enterprise Strategy With Field Automation - Cost savings of
greater than 25% are occurring with field automation. Can
hand-helds leverage workers, get the company closer to the
customer and lead to greater savings in re-engineering?
Discussion will also cover the role of field automation in new
Utility business opportunities.
* Field Service Applications - Customer Service. Case reviews in
order management, dispatch, field sales, hand-held based
meter reading and more.
* Work Order Management Applications - Distribution and
Generation. Case reviews in field inspections, pole
maintenance, asset management, line extensions, corrosion
control, meter maintenance and more. |
